Ordering a 2017 Emerald Green or settling....
I have narrowed my search down to a new s550 Sedan. I am sure I want the premium pkg and drivers assistance plus maybe the surround view. But 2016 doesn't seem to be much diff than 2017 and certainly has some better deals available.
But i really like the emerald green (not the blackish green on a few 2016s) at least from the sample. Haven't been able to find any in inventory around Houston and assume no easy way to check national inventory??
Your thoughts on the color and factory ordering please....also any suggestions on surround view or other options you like would be appreciated.

I ordered one today in emerald green. Sort of frustrating. Turns out that just because you can build one on the website doesnt even remotely mean you can get it in real life. Option x23 requires G24 and 407 and an option starting with B and any mercenne prime... well, at the end of the day I dropped down in the designo interiors from near the top (which require everything everywhere) to the least expensive nonstandard ones...
